Understanding Asphalt and Concrete Costs for Shopping Center Paving

When considering paving options for a shopping center, understanding the cost dynamics of asphalt versus concrete is crucial. Both materials have their merits when it comes to mall parking lots, but they significantly differ in terms of initial investment and long-term maintenance expenses. Asphalt, often the preferred choice for its versatility and relatively lower upfront costs, typically ranges from $2 to $4 per square foot, making it a shopper-friendly option for budget-conscious retailers. On the other hand, concrete, known for its durability and aesthetic appeal, commands a higher price point, averaging between $5 to $8 per square foot, but its longevity can reduce maintenance needs over time.
The decision should factor in not just initial costs but also ongoing maintenance requirements. Asphalt, while easier and faster to repair, requires more frequent replacement due to its susceptibility to oil stains, heat damage, and extreme weather conditions. Concrete, though requiring significant upfront investment, offers a more permanent solution with minimal maintenance needs, only needing periodic sealing and cleaning. Maintaining shopping center aesthetics is paramount, and concrete’s ability to accommodate custom designs and seamless repairs ensures it aligns with the overall aesthetic goals of modern retail spaces.
Ultimately, choosing between asphalt and concrete depends on balancing immediate budget considerations against long-term sustainability and shopper experience. Durability and Maintenance Comparisons: Longevity in Parking Lots

When considering paving options for shopping center parking lots, a fundamental factor to evaluate is longevity and durability. Asphalt and concrete are two commonly used materials, each offering distinct advantages and maintenance requirements. In this context, understanding their durability and the implications for long-term cost-effectiveness is paramount.
Asphalt, often the preferred choice for many commercial properties, including shopping centers, exhibits superior flexibility and resistance to cracks. This characteristic makes it relatively easier to repair and maintain, especially in areas prone to heavy traffic and temperature fluctuations. Richard Diehl Paving, a renowned expert, highlights that asphalt’s low initial cost and ease of repair can lead to significant long-term savings. For instance, repairs for small cracks or damage can be as simple as hot-asphalt topping, minimizing disruptive closures compared to concrete repairs. However, over time, asphalt may require more frequent resealing and maintenance due to its tendency to oxidize and lose flexibility.
On the other hand, concrete offers exceptional compressive strength and durability, making it ideal for heavy-load applications. When properly constructed and maintained, concrete parking lots can last several decades with minimal deterioration. Nevertheless, concrete’s rigid nature makes it more susceptible to cracks, especially under stress. Repairing these cracks, particularly in larger shopping centers, can be intricate and costly. A study by the National Asphalt Paving Association (NAPA) suggests that while initial installation costs for concrete might be higher, its longevity can result in lower overall maintenance expenses over a 20-year period compared to asphalt.

Installation and Construction Considerations for Each Material

When considering efficient mall paving solutions for shopping center entrances, a critical comparison lies between asphalt and concrete. Each material presents distinct advantages and considerations during installation and construction, impacting both cost and long-term performance.
Asphalt, a versatile and cost-effective option, offers rapid installation and superior flexibility. It’s particularly well-suited for high-traffic areas like mall parking lots due to its ability to withstand heavy loads and provide a smooth surface. However, asphalt is more susceptible to temperature variations, leading to potential cracks and necessitating regular maintenance. Additionally, while initial costs may be lower, long-term expenses for repairs and frequent replacement can accumulate over time.
Concrete, known for its durability and strength, offers a solid foundation for modernizing shopping center entrances. It’s less prone to weather-related damage and provides a more uniform surface. The construction process is labor-intensive, requiring skilled artisans and specialized equipment, which can increase installation times and costs. However, concrete’s longevity ensures minimal maintenance requirements and cost savings over the long term.
